2014-11-04 92 views
0

我使用運行org.eclipse.emf.cdo.server的運行配置創建了CDO服務器.product.tcp_h2作爲產品。這工作絕對正常,沒有任何錯誤。創建Eclipse產品配置時出錯:org.h2.jdbcx.JdbcDataSource找不到org.eclipse.net4j.db

不過,我試圖創造出基於這個現有的產品,導致一個產品配置:

java.lang.ClassNotFoundException: org.h2.jdbcx.JdbcDataSource cannot be found by org.eclipse.net4j.db_4.3.0.v20140114-0640 

我還沒有做出的運行配置和產品配置之間的任何變化。

是否有人知道問題的可能原因以及爲什麼產品配置的行爲方式與現有運行配置不同?

+1

大多數情況下,這是由您的產品中缺少一些插件引起的。你是否設置了cdo.server.feature插件,如果你這樣做了:你是否在feature.xml中定義了插件?它應該包含org.h2。 – Calon 2014-11-19 10:29:40

回答

0

Calon評論說,問題是由於缺少插件。我更新了meta-inf依賴關係,它工作正常。